Williams' newsagents in Audlem is where many local people buy their coal throughout the year.

Now, Judy Evan's coal merchant at Williams', G Owen & Sons of Newtown, Powys in central Wales, say they were so moved by the TV coverage they saw of Audlem singing Amazing Grace, they have donated a tonne of coal to Mend our Mum.

So, instead of Judy paying G Owens for all that coal bought at Williams' as you buy your supplies for Christmas, the wholesale value of £240 will be paid into the Mend our Mum fund.

What a lovely gift to the village's fund-raising from Wales!
